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Daten in Speichern ohne carriage return

Forumthread: Daten in Speichern ohne carriage return

Daten in Speichern ohne carriage return
19.09.2007 16:06:00
Ralf
Hallo zusammen,
mit folgendem Code kann ich Daten sammeln und in einer Txt-Datei abspeichen. Funktioniert auch soweit, nur am ende des Strings in der Txt-Datei wird noch ein "carriage return" erzeugt. Wie kann man das erzeugen des letzten "carriage return" unterbinden?
Vielleicht kann jemand helfen?
Gruß Ralf

Sub Speichern()
Dim liZeile As Integer, lstrInhalt As String
For liZeile = 1 To 20
lstrInhalt = lstrInhalt & "" & Range("A" & liZeile).Value
Next
Open "deinPfad\deinDateiname.txt" For Output As #1
Print #1, lstrInhalt
Close
lstrInhalt = ""
End Sub


Anzeige

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Daten in Speichern ohne carriage return
19.09.2007 20:15:00
Horst
Hi,
unter Excel 2003 nicht nachvollziebar.
mfg Horst

AW: Daten in Speichern ohne carriage return
19.09.2007 21:37:37
Nepumuk
Hallo Ralf,
einfach so:
Print #1, lstrInhalt;

Gruß
Nepumuk

Anzeige
AW: Daten in Speichern ohne carriage return
19.09.2007 21:42:21
Harry
Hallo Ralf,
vielleicht so?

Sub Speichern()
Dim liZeile As Integer, lstrInhalt As String
For liZeile = 1 To 20
lstrInhalt = lstrInhalt & "" & Range("A" & liZeile).Value
Next
lstrInhalt = Left(lstrInhalt, Len(lstrInhalt) - 1) 'letztes Zeichen abtrennen...
Open "deinPfad\deinDateiname.txt" For Output As #1
Print #1, lstrInhalt
Close
lstrInhalt = ""
End Sub


Gruß
Harry

Anzeige
AW: Daten in Speichern ohne carriage return
20.09.2007 12:11:00
Ralf
Hallo Nepomuk, Hallo Harry,
vielen Dank für die Mühe.
Der Tip von Nepomuk führt zum gewünschten Ergebnis. :-)
Gruß Ralf

Man lernt laufend neues.... :-) o.w.T.
20.09.2007 18:22:35
Harry
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ige